As a result of the worldwide availability of raw materials, and low natural gas fuel cost, the construction of new fertilizer production plants in the U.S. has grown. Furthermore, the use of dry fertilizer in various gardening and farming applications has also increased. Louisiana residents and businesses will find it interesting to learn that recently, Heumann Environmental, a Louisville, KY company was awarded a nearly six million dollar contract to provide scrubber technology to two granulated fertilizer plants currently under construction. One fertilizer plant expected to receive this technology is in Donaldsonville, LA.

Heumann Environmental was selected for the job by Kimre, Inc., a Miami, FL based company that manufactures mesh technology for process fluid separation and air pollution control. Heumann designs, builds and installs customized air pollution control ventilation systems. The company is expected to design and build a scrubber containing Kimre’s media. Heumann Environmental is expected to perform over the next ten months under this deal.
